Overview of the Function: The Credit team is responsible for detailed risk evaluation of clients and discussion with management/bankers of borrowers, preparation of CAN (Credit Appraisal Note), discussion with internal stakeholders, and ongoing account monitoring. Your Role at CredAble • Conducting detailed research on the financial history of businesses and individuals to determine client’s creditworthiness. • Appraising prospective clients and preparation of CAN (Credit Appraisal Note) along with financial sheet as per the prescribed format • Monitor clients’ compliance with credit terms on an ongoing basis; identify and advise early warning signals. Conduct periodic evaluation to ensure quality of accounts/portfolio. • Appraising industries and lending eco-systems and help in creating innovative lending products • Updating the management team on key developments in the lending space. • Conducting detailed research on the financial history of businesses and individuals to determine their creditworthiness. • Regular interaction with internal stakeholders (RM/Ops etc.) to be well informed of the activities related to clients • Drawing conclusions from available data (both quantitative and qualitative) regarding the creditworthiness the client. • Identify early signs of stress in any account by continuously monitoring both external and internal reports/triggers. Engage with stakeholders for flagging of risk pertaining to borrowers which are proposed to be included in EWS Qualifications Exp- 4-10 years.
